[0024] A method for predicting disasters in the production process of an oil and gas well adjacent to a working face, specifically the following operations:
[0025] 1. Select a coal mining face 200 meters away from abandoned oil and gas wells in the coal mine, and collect basic data such as mining height, daily advance rate, and mine pressure data of the working face.
[0026] 2. According to the collected parameters of the coal mining face, use FLAC 3D The software conducts numerical modeling to analyze the stress distribution of the coal mining face's inlet and return air channels. Through calculation, the peak value of the lateral bearing pressure, the range of influence and the maximum shear stress of the coal mining face are obtained.
